Secondary raw materials like (oxidized) scrap and residues are another important feed for chemical tungsten processing. Wolframite concentrates can also be smelted directly with charcoal or coke in an electric arc furnace to produce ferrotungsten (FeW) which is used as alloying material in steel production.

Wolframite and scheelite are typical tungsten mineral concentrates. These ores contain 60-70% tungsten xide (WO₃). Tungsten concentrate is sourced directly from miners and commodity traders. Combining tungsten concentrate (≈65% WO₃), pitch coke, ferrosilicon and scrap iron, this forms the ingredients to produce ferrotungsten.

The first step in the production of tungsten is to enrich tungsten from two minerals wolframite ((Fe, Mn)WO4) and scheelite (CaWO4) through the leaching process. The leaching residue usually contains a certain amount (2–5 wt%) of WO3 which is higher than that in the tungsten ore (generally less than 1 wt%). In addition, the leaching …
